Located in Lafayette, CA, Carmen Sanz Pickleball Club is preparing to help players make the most of the upcoming DUPR Reset period, taking place March 16 to May 17, 2026. Carmen Sanz, the club’s director, shared that the club plans to integrate DUPR Reset opportunities directly into its programming to help players gain clarity, confidence, and a reason to step on the court when the Reset period begins.

A Chance to Compete with Confidence

Carmen Sanz sees the DUPR Reset as an exciting opportunity for players across all skill levels. She noted that some players are looking for an opportunity to validate their skill level and some players feel as though their rating does not reflect their current level.

As Carmen notes, the Reset “gives everyone a reason to step on the court and compete.”

How Carmen Sanz Pickleball Club is Integrating DUPR Reset

According to Carmen, the club plans to implement the Reset through a thoughtful and structured approach designed to support both casual and competitive players:

  • Embedded Reset Opportunities in SUPR DUPR Tour Events: Players will be able to complete their required 8-match minimum for a Reset in a competitive, organized environment. 
  • Small-Group Reset Pods: Groups of 4-8 players will provide a controlled and efficient experience while also helping doubles players meet the requirement of playing with at least two different partners and singles players face two different opponents to qualify for a Reset.
  • Education on Match Volume: While 8 matches are sufficient to complete the Reset, Carmen encourages players to log closer to 30 matches to provide more data so the rating calculation is stronger and better reflects their true skill level.

By combining these strategies, the club provides a structured and social setting where players can build confidence, compete fairly, and enjoy a supportive community.

Building Momentum and Community

As the Reset period approaches, the excitement at Carmen Sanz Pickleball Club is evident. Carmen shared that players at the club are realizing that the Reset is an opportunity and there’s no risk. 

“When a community moves together with that mindset, growth happens naturally,” she mentioned.

Carmen hopes that other facilities will adopt similar approaches, using the Reset not only to update pickleball ratings but also to encourage participation in pickleball tournaments and strengthen the sense of community around the sport.

The DUPR Reset is completely optional and risk-free. After the Reset Period ends, a player’s DUPR is set to the higher of their Reset rating or original rating.
